FAQs

How do I ignite the burners?

Simply turn and press the knob for the desired burner. The integrated ignition will automatically light the flame.

What type of gas does this hob use?

This hob uses natural gas, but an LPG conversion kit is included for use with LPG gas.

How do I clean the cast iron pan supports?

Remove the pan supports and wash them with warm, soapy water. Rinse and dry thoroughly.

What should I do if a burner flame goes out?

The flame failure device will automatically cut off the gas supply. Turn off the burner and wait a few minutes before trying to relight it. If the problem persists, contact a gas engineer.

What are the dimensions of the hob?

The hob dimensions are 745mm wide, 510mm deep, and 40mm high. Installation compartment depth is 48cm, installation compartment width is 56cm, and installation compartment height is 4cm.

What type of electrical connection does this hob require?

It requires a standard 13 Amp socket.

Can I use different sized pans on the burners?

Yes, but it's best to use pans that match the burner size for optimal efficiency and safety.

Troubleshooting

Burner won't light.

Check the gas supply and ensure the burner is clean. Make sure the ignition is working correctly. If the problem persists, contact a qualified gas engineer.

Flame is uneven or too low.

Clean the burner ports with a small needle or wire. Ensure the burner cap is correctly positioned. Check for any gas supply issues.

Hob is not level.

Adjust the hob's feet until it sits level within the countertop cutout. Use a spirit level to verify.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Installation

This gas hob *must* be installed by a qualified Gas Safe engineer in the UK. Ensure that the gas supply is compatible with the hob's specifications.

Electrical Connection

The hob requires a standard 13 Amp socket for electrical connection.

Compatibility

Check your kitchen's dimensions to ensure that the hob fits within the installation compartment. Refer to the product specifications for exact measurements.

Care

  • Clean the hob regularly with a damp cloth and mild detergent.
  • Wipe up spills immediately to prevent staining.
  • Clean the cast iron pan supports with warm, soapy water. Avoid abrasive cleaners.
  • Ensure that the burner ports are clean and free of obstructions.
  • Always allow the hob to cool completely before cleaning.
